HOME PROGRAMS AND ACADEMIC DEPARTMENTS FACULTY OF ARTS PUBLIC ADMINISTRATION AND GOVERNANCE (Part-Time Only) BACHELOR OF ARTS (PUBLIC ADMINISTRATION AND GOVERNANCE) LEVEL 3

LEVEL 3

REQUIRED:  

POG 413 E-Government and Restructuring
PPA 600 Financial Management
PPA 602 Program Planning and Evaluation
PPA 624 Theories of Bureaucracy
PPA 650 Intergovernmental Relations
 
PPA 601 Collaborative Governance
OR
PPA 701 Aboriginal Public/Private Partnerships
 
PPA 603 Comparative Public Policy
OR
PPA 700 Comparative Aboriginal Politics/Policies
 
PPA 604 Issues in Public Administration
OR
PPA 704 Current Issues in Aboriginal Governance
 
PPA 629 Administrative Law
OR
PPA 702 Admin Law in an Aboriginal Context

REQUIRED GROUP 1: One course from the following: 

PPA 30A/B Practicum
PPA 31A/B Public Policy Research Paper

REQUIRED GROUP 2*: Two courses from the following (not previously taken): 

POG 110 Canadian Politics
POG 310 Ontario Politics
POG 440 Aboriginal Governance/Justice
POG 443 Global Cities
POL 122 Local Government in Canada

LIBERAL STUDIES: Four courses. One of which may be taken from Table A, the other three from Table B.

PROFESSIONALLY-RELATED*: Seven courses from Table I.


¶ In order to be eligible to enroll in the Practicum (PPA 30A/B), students must have two years of appropriate work experience in the public, para-public, or non-profit sectors, and must have their application approved by the Practicum Committee. Please consult the Department of Politics and Public Administration.

* Students completing the Practicum PPA 30A/B, are exempt from the Required Group 2 requirement, and require only two Professionally-Related courses.
† First Nations students will complete PPA 701, PPA 700, PPA 704 and PPA 702 respectively as noted above.
